Step 1
Preheat the oven to medium broil.
Step 2
Line a large cookie sheet with aluminum foil, then spray with non-stick vegetable spray.
Step 3
Place the tilapia fillets on the sheet leaving at least 1 inch between the fillets.
Step 4
Using a pastry brush or spatula, brush the fillets with mayonnaise.
Step 5
Evenly sprinkle the parmesan over the fillets, then dust with paprika.
Step 6
Broil for 20 minutes, until fillets are browned and completely cooked through.
Step 7
Serve with a crusty garlic bread and soup for a hearty meal!
